
要做好数据仓库的管理工作,可以从以下几个方面入手:1、数据质量管理;2、数据安全和权限管理;3、性能优化;4、数据备份与恢复;5、数据架构设计。
数据质量管理是数据仓库管理的核心任务之一。确保数据的准确性、完整性和一致性是数据仓库成功的关键。可以通过实施数据清洗、数据校验和数据监控等措施来提高数据质量。例如,定期进行数据质量审核,识别并纠正数据中的错误和不一致性。同时,建立数据标准和数据字典,以确保数据在不同系统之间的一致性。
一、数据质量管理
-
数据清洗
- 数据清洗是指通过对数据进行过滤、转换和纠正,去除数据中的错误和冗余信息。
- 采用自动化工具和手动检查相结合的方法,提高数据清洗的效率和准确性。
-
数据校验
- 数据校验是指对数据进行验证,以确保数据的准确性和一致性。
- 使用数据校验规则,如格式校验、范围校验和逻辑校验等,确保数据符合预期。
-
数据监控
- 数据监控是指对数据进行持续监控,及时发现和纠正数据中的问题。
- 建立数据监控机制,如数据异常检测和数据质量报告,确保数据质量的持续提高。
二、数据安全和权限管理
-
数据加密
- 采用数据加密技术,保护数据在传输和存储过程中的安全。
- 使用强加密算法,如AES和RSA,确保数据的机密性和完整性。
-
用户认证和授权
- 实施严格的用户认证和授权机制,确保只有授权用户才能访问数据。
- 使用多因素认证和角色权限控制,增强数据访问的安全性。
-
数据审计
- 进行数据审计,记录数据访问和操作日志,确保数据使用的透明性和可追溯性。
- 定期审查数据访问和操作日志,及时发现和处理数据安全事件。
三、性能优化
-
索引优化
- 通过建立适当的索引,提高数据查询的效率和响应速度。
- 定期维护和优化索引,确保索引的有效性和性能。
-
分区管理
- 对数据进行分区管理,减少数据查询和处理的范围,提高数据访问的速度。
- 根据数据的使用频率和访问模式,合理划分数据分区,确保数据的高效管理。
-
缓存机制
- 采用缓存机制,减少数据查询的延迟和负载,提高数据访问的效率。
- 使用内存缓存和磁盘缓存相结合的方法,平衡缓存的性能和成本。
四、数据备份与恢复
-
定期备份
- 制定数据备份策略,定期进行数据备份,确保数据的安全性和可恢复性。
- 采用多种备份方式,如全备份、增量备份和差异备份,确保数据备份的完整性和效率。
-
数据恢复
- 建立数据恢复机制,确保在数据丢失或损坏时能够及时恢复数据。
- 定期进行数据恢复演练,确保数据恢复的可行性和有效性。
-
备份存储
- 选择可靠的备份存储介质和存储位置,确保数据备份的安全性和可用性。
- 使用云存储和异地备份相结合的方法,提高数据备份的安全性和可用性。
五、数据架构设计
-
数据模型
- 设计合理的数据模型,确保数据的结构化和规范化。
- 使用数据建模工具和方法,如ER模型和维度建模,确保数据模型的准确性和一致性。
-
数据集成
- 通过数据集成技术,实现数据在不同系统之间的共享和交换。
- 使用ETL工具和数据集成平台,确保数据集成的高效性和可靠性。
-
数据治理
- 实施数据治理,确保数据在整个生命周期中的质量和管理。
- 建立数据治理框架和政策,确保数据治理的有效性和可持续性。
总结起来,要做好数据仓库的管理工作,需要从多个方面入手,包括数据质量管理、数据安全和权限管理、性能优化、数据备份与恢复和数据架构设计。通过实施这些措施,可以提高数据仓库的管理水平,确保数据的准确性、安全性和可用性,从而支持企业的决策和业务发展。
进一步建议,企业可以借助专业的数据仓库管理工具和平台,如简道云WMS仓库管理系统,来提升数据仓库的管理效率和效果。了解更多关于简道云WMS仓库管理系统的信息,可以访问官网: https://s.fanruan.com/q6mjx;。
相关问答FAQs:
如何有效管理数据仓库?
数据仓库的管理是一个复杂而重要的任务,涉及多个方面的考虑。为了确保数据仓库的高效性和可靠性,组织需要采取一系列的最佳实践和策略。
1. 设定明确的目标和需求
在开始数据仓库的建设和管理之前,组织需要清晰地定义目标和需求。了解数据仓库的主要用途,包括业务分析、报告生成、数据挖掘等,能够帮助团队在设计阶段做出明智的决策。
2. 选择合适的技术平台
选择合适的数据仓库技术平台至关重要。市面上有多种解决方案,例如Amazon Redshift、Google BigQuery、Snowflake等。每种技术都有其优缺点,组织应根据自己的需求、预算和技术能力进行选择。
3. 数据建模
数据建模是数据仓库管理中不可或缺的一部分。通过采用星型模式、雪花模式等建模技术,能够有效地组织和存储数据。良好的数据模型不仅提高查询性能,还能提升数据的可理解性。
4. 数据质量管理
确保数据质量是数据仓库管理的核心。实施数据清洗、数据验证和数据监控等措施,能够保证数据的准确性和一致性。定期进行数据质量评估,并及时修复问题,能够有效降低数据错误带来的负面影响。
5. 安全性和合规性
数据仓库中存储的通常是业务关键数据,因此数据安全性和合规性至关重要。组织应实施多层次的安全措施,包括访问控制、数据加密和审计日志等。同时,确保遵循相关法律法规(如GDPR、CCPA等),以保护用户隐私。
6. 性能优化
数据仓库的性能直接影响到业务决策的效率。定期进行性能监控,识别瓶颈,并采取相应的优化措施,例如索引优化、查询优化和资源分配优化等,以确保系统的响应速度和处理能力。
7. 定期备份和恢复策略
备份是数据仓库管理中不可忽视的环节。制定清晰的备份策略,定期进行数据备份,以防止数据丢失。确保恢复流程的有效性,能够在发生故障时快速恢复系统,减少业务中断时间。
8. 用户培训与支持
数据仓库的成功不仅依赖于技术,还需要用户的积极参与。提供系统的用户培训,帮助员工掌握数据仓库的使用方法和数据分析技巧。同时,设立支持团队,及时解决用户在使用过程中遇到的问题。
9. 持续监控与改进
数据仓库的管理是一个持续的过程。通过定期评估数据仓库的性能、数据质量和用户反馈,识别改进的机会,能够确保数据仓库始终满足业务需求,并在快速变化的市场环境中保持竞争力。
10. 制定清晰的文档和流程
完善的文档和流程能够帮助团队更高效地管理数据仓库。记录系统架构、数据模型、数据流和操作流程等信息,确保团队成员能够快速上手并减少知识流失。
数据仓库的常见管理挑战及其解决方案
在管理数据仓库的过程中,组织可能会面临多种挑战。识别这些挑战并采取相应的解决方案,能够显著提升管理效率。
1. 数据孤岛
数据孤岛是指不同系统之间的数据无法有效共享,导致信息孤立。通过实施数据集成工具和ETL(抽取、转换、加载)流程,可以有效打破数据孤岛,实现数据的集中管理和共享。
2. 数据更新延迟
数据更新的延迟会影响分析的及时性。通过引入实时数据处理技术和流数据处理工具,能够确保数据仓库中的数据能够及时更新,支持实时分析。
3. 用户需求多样性
不同的用户对数据的需求各不相同,可能造成管理上的复杂性。通过灵活的查询和报表工具,能够满足不同用户的需求。同时,建立用户反馈机制,定期收集需求,以便进行相应调整。
4. 技术快速变化
随着技术的快速发展,数据仓库的管理工具和技术也在不断演进。保持对新技术的关注,定期进行技术评估和更新,能够帮助组织在竞争中保持优势。
5. 成本控制
数据仓库的建设和维护成本可能会相对较高。通过优化资源使用、选择合适的云服务方案和实施成本监控,能够有效控制数据仓库的整体运营成本。
6. 人才短缺
数据仓库的管理需要专业的人才,但许多组织在这一领域面临人才短缺的问题。通过加强内部培训、吸引外部专家和与高校合作,能够培养和引进所需的人才。
结论
有效管理数据仓库是一个系统工程,涉及多个方面的协调与配合。通过设定明确目标、选择合适技术、确保数据质量、强化安全性以及用户培训等措施,能够大幅提升数据仓库的管理效率。面对各种管理挑战,及时识别问题并采取相应措施,能够确保数据仓库在支持业务决策方面发挥其最大价值。
简道云WMS仓库管理系统模板:
无需下载,在线即可使用: https://s.fanruan.com/q6mjx;
阅读时间:7 分钟
浏览量:5725次




























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








